Option B
Almost
2,000 years ago, on the Jewish Feast of Pentecost,
the apostles left the Upper Room,
where they had been hiding for fear of the Jews,
and went out fearlessly to preach the Gospel to the world.
They could not have done this
without the Holy Spirit, the "power from on high".
That day a new community,
the Christian church, was born.
As we, the new People of God,
celebrate the birthday of our Church,
we realize that we, too, are in need a fresh
outpouring of the Spirit of God. And so we pray:
